windshield wipers won't turn off

I have a 1996 civic, and

My windshield wipers are stuck in the "on" mode, regardless of the position of the switch. It is stuck at medium speed in the off, intermittent, and medium speed positions, though it does enter maximum speed when set there.

Any suggestions?

And is there a quick way to disengage the whole system so that I can drive safely in dry weather until I fix the problem?

There may be a fuse for just the wipers that you can pull, but there may be other things on the same circuit, Study the fuse diagram first. (Owner's manual, or on the fuse block covers). You could also try unplugging the wiper switch. You should also check that there isn't a short in the wiring, that could lead to bad things if it doesn't get fixed.
